Kartsopheli[1] (Georgian: კართსოფელი; Ossetian: Хъаратыхъæу, Qaratyqæw — ″village of the Qaratæ″) is a village in the historical region of Khevi, north-eastern Georgia. It is located on the left bank of the river Tergi. Administratively, it is part of the Kazbegi Municipality in Mtskheta-Mtianeti. Distance to the municipality center Stepantsminda is 38 km.
